10. There will be only THREE presidential debates, and ONE for the VP candidates - see below
Thu Apr 19, 2012, 07:37 PM
Apr 2012

First
October 3, University of Denver, Denver, Colorado

Second (town-meeting format)
October 16, Hofstra University, Hempstead, New York

Third
October 22, Lynn University, Boca Raton, Florida

=====

Vice presidential
October 11, Centre College, Danville, Kentucky
